Output 03f58950c2b758ec48bb97792500f66b1450fac95ed89119734a458756b3a8bd:1

value
1268830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70bd895a8dcd581e97ce27b6672d12846de0269 OP_EQUAL
address
3MJ5Ps5DhNXCgjaKpDZyt6bUosrNXm4tc5
transaction
03f58950c2b758ec48bb97792500f66b1450fac95ed89119734a458756b3a8bd
spent
true